Champagne Legret & Fils

Champagne Legret & Fils is a small family-owned Champagne producer. Alain and Sandrine are the fourth generation. Alain joined his parents in 1986, the estate became an independent grower in 2000 and Alain and Sandrine took the lead in 2006 when Jean-Pierre and Jacqueline retired.

Alain and Sandrine farm 5 hectares of vines. The winery is located in Talus-Saint-Prix, north of Sézanne, in direction of Epernay. The vineyards are on the slopes of the Valley of the Petit Morin and in the Sézannais. They grow Pinot Noir and Meunier in Talus-Sain-Prix and Oye, on south-facing clayey-silty plots, and Chardonnay on plots in Sézanne and Barbonne, where the limestone subsoils suit Chardonnay best.

Since Alain took the lead, he has kept moving toward sustainability and natural practices. The estate has been Terra Vitis certified since 2017, and has launched its organic conversion and certification in 2018 (conversion being achieved now). All wines are also Vegan certified. The estate has launched a vitiforestry program in 2020. The current wine lineup is made of six champagnes, four white and two rosé, brut-nature and extra brut, with one vintage Champagne.
